Arugula salad with lemon vinaigrette

Serves 6

1 large bunch fresh arugula, rinsed and stemmed
Juice of 1 lemon
Salt and pepper, to taste
1/4 cup olive oil
1/2 shallot, finely chopped
Small wedge of Parmesan

1. In a salad bowl, place the arugula leaves.

2. In a small bowl, stir together the lemon, salt, and pepper. Slowly whisk in the olive oil until the mixture is blended. Stir in the shallots.

3. Toss the arugula with the dressing. Divide among 6 salad plates. Sprinkle with a pinch of salt and pepper. With a rotary vegetable peeler, shave pieces of Parmesan onto the greens. Christine Merlo
